Select Energy Services Reports Second Quarter Results 2018

August 9, 2018 4:30 PM

HOUSTON, Aug. 9, 2018 /PRNewswire/ -- Select Energy Services, Inc. (NYSE: WTTR) ("Select" or "the Company"), a leading provider of total water management and chemical solutions to the North American unconventional oil and gas industry, today announced results for the quarter ended June 30, 2018.

Revenue for the second quarter of 2018 was $393.2 million as compared to $376.4 million in the first quarter of 2018 and $134.4 million in the second quarter of 2017. Net income for the second quarter of 2018 was $25.0 million as compared to $16.1 million in the first quarter of 2018 and a net loss of $10.5 million in the second quarter of 2017. Adjusted EBITDA was $68.2 million or 17.3% of revenue in the second quarter of 2018 as compared to $59.6 million or 15.8% of revenue in the first quarter of 2018. Business Segment Information

The Water Solutions segment generated revenues of $273.7 million in the second quarter of 2018 as compared to revenues of $257.5 million in the first quarter of 2018 and $107.8 million in the second quarter of 2017. Increased customer demand for Select's water transfer and flowback and well testing services in the Permian was the primary driver of this increase.

The Oilfield Chemicals segment, which operates through our subsidiary Rockwater Energy Solutions, generated revenues of $64.8 million in the second quarter of 2018 as compared to $63.6 million in the first quarter of 2018. Rising sales of friction reducer products offset declines in guar and crosslinker volumes.

The Wellsite Services segment generated revenues of $54.7 million in the second quarter of 2018 as compared to revenues of $55.2 million in the first quarter of 2018 and $26.6 million in the second quarter of 2017. Increased activity in our accommodations and sand hauling business lines was offset by seasonal activity declines in Canada for spring breakup.

Select's consolidated gross profit was $56.7 million in the second quarter of 2018 as compared to $47.9 million in the first quarter of 2018. Total gross margin for Select was 14.4% in the second quarter of 2018 as compared to 12.7% in the first quarter of 2018. Gross margin before depreciation and amortization ("D&A") for Water Solutions was 25.6% in the second quarter of 2018 as compared to 24.6% in the first quarter of 2018. Gross margin before D&A for Oilfield Chemicals was 9.7% in the second quarter of 2018 as compared to 10.3% in the first quarter of 2018. Gross margin before D&A for Wellsite Services was 19.8% in the second quarter of 2018 as compared to 15.9% in the first quarter of 2018. Please refer to the reconciliation of gross profit before D&A (a non-GAAP measure) to gross profit in this release.

Included in the first and second quarter of 2018 segment results were full-quarter contributions from Rockwater Energy Solutions, which Select acquired in November 2017; as such, these results are not included in 2017 second quarter results.

Cash Flow and Balance Sheet

Cash flow from operations for the six-month period ending June 30, 2018 was $64.3 million, of which $29.1 million was generated in the second quarter of 2018. Capital expenditures for the first half of the year were $59.1 million, net of asset sales of $4.0 million, of which $28.1 million was spent in the 2018 second quarter. Both our 2018 year-to-date and second quarter net capital expenditures were fully funded with cash flow from operations.

Total liquidity was $199.9 million as of June 30, 2018, as compared to $166.9 million as of March 31, 2018. The Company had approximately $188.6 million of available borrowing capacity under its revolving credit facility, after giving effect to $18.3 million of outstanding letters of credit. Total cash and cash equivalents were $11.3 million at June 30, 2018 as compared to $6.1 million at March 31, 2018, and outstanding borrowings as of June 30, 2018 totaled $80.0 million.

About Select Energy Services, Inc.

Select is a leading provider of total water management and chemical solutions to the North American unconventional oil and gas industry. Select provides for the sourcing and transfer of water, both by permanent pipeline and temporary hose, prior to its use in the drilling and completion activities associated with hydraulic fracturing, as well as complementary water-related services that support oil and gas well completion and production activities, including containment, monitoring, treatment and recycling, flowback, hauling, and disposal. Select, under its Rockwater Energy Solutions brand, develops and manufactures a full suite of specialty chemicals used in the well completion process and production chemicals used to enhance performance over the producing life of a well. Select currently provides services to exploration and production companies and oilfield service companies operating in all the major shale and producing basins in the United States and Western Canada. Comparison of Non-GAAP Financial Measures

EBITDA, Adjusted EBITDA, gross profit before depreciation and amortization (D&A) and gross margin before D&A are not financial measures presented in accordance with GAAP. We define EBITDA as net income, plus interest expense, taxes and depreciation & amortization. We define Adjusted EBITDA as EBITDA plus/(minus) loss/(income) from discontinued operations, plus any impairment charges or asset write-offs pursuant to GAAP, plus/(minus) non-cash losses/(gains) on the sale of assets or subsidiaries, non-recurring compensation expense, non-cash compensation expense, and non-recurring or unusual expenses or charges, including severance expenses, transaction costs, or facilities-related exit and disposal-related expenditures, plus/(minus) foreign currency losses/(gains) and plus any inventory write-downs. We define gross profit before D&A as revenue less cost of revenue, excluding cost of sales D&A expense. We define gross margin before D&A as gross profit before D&A divided by revenue. EBITDA, Adjusted EBITDA, gross profit before D&A and gross margin before D&A are supplemental non-GAAP financial measures that we believe provide useful information to external users of our financial statements, such as industry analysts, investors, lenders and rating agencies because it allows them to compare our operating performance on a consistent basis across periods by removing the effects of our capital structure (such as varying levels of interest expense), asset base (such as depreciation and amortization) and non-recurring items outside the control of our management team. We present EBITDA, Adjusted EBITDA, gross profit before D&A and gross margin before D&A because we believe they provide useful information regarding the factors and trends affecting our business in addition to measures calculated under GAAP.

Net income is the GAAP measure most directly comparable to EBITDA and Adjusted EBITDA. Gross profit is the GAAP measure most directly comparable to gross profit before D&A.
